Article 4 Direction Area
Dwellinghouses (C3) to small HMOs (C4) - borough-wide Article 4 Direction · reference A4D.2 · covers 25 of 26 premises. Some normally permitted changes may require planning permission.
Archaeological Priority Area
Summary and Definition The Archaeological Priority Area covers the medieval and post-medieval settlement of Isleworth and the adjacent section of the Thames foreshore which includes the Isleworth Ait (island). The APA · reference 220944 · covers 23 of 26 premises. Groundworks may require archaeological assessment or investigation.
